Why Secure Hardware Disposal is Important
1. Protecting Sensitive Data
When hardware is retired or replaced, it often contains sensitive data that must be securely erased to prevent unauthorised access. Failure to do so can lead to data breaches, which can have serious legal and reputational consequences for businesses.
2. Environmental Responsibility
Electronic waste contains hazardous materials that can be harmful to the environment if not disposed of correctly. Secure disposal practices ensure that e-waste is processed in an environmentally responsible manner, reducing the impact on landfills and ecosystems.
3. Regulatory Compliance
Compliance with regulations and standards related to data protection and e-waste management is essential. Proper disposal helps meet legal requirements, such as GDPR for data protection and WEEE (Waste Electrical and Electronic Equipment) Directive for e-waste.
Lightyear Hosting’s Approach to Secure Hardware Disposal
At Lightyear Hosting, we have established stringent procedures for the secure disposal of hardware to ensure data security and environmental sustainability. Here’s how we handle hardware disposal:
1. Data Erasure and Destruction
1.1 Comprehensive Data Wiping:
- Software-Based Erasure: We use advanced data wiping software to overwrite data on hard drives and other storage devices. This process ensures that data cannot be recovered by unauthorised parties.
- Multiple Passes: For maximum security, data is often overwritten multiple times to ensure that no residual data remains.
1.2 Physical Destruction:
- Shredding: Hard drives and other storage media are physically shredded to ensure that they are completely destroyed and cannot be reconstructed or recovered.
- Crushing: In some cases, drives are crushed using specialised equipment to ensure complete data destruction.
2. E-Waste Recycling
2.1 Responsible Recycling Partners:
- Certified Recyclers: We partner with certified e-waste recyclers who adhere to industry standards for safe and responsible recycling.
- Eco-Friendly Practices: Recyclers are selected based on their commitment to environmentally friendly practices, including the safe handling of hazardous materials.
2.2 Component Recovery:
- Material Recovery: Recyclers recover valuable materials from electronic components, such as metals and plastics, which are then processed and reused.
- Reduced Landfill Impact: By recycling, we reduce the amount of e-waste that ends up in landfills, minimising environmental impact.
3. Documentation and Compliance
3.1 Certificates of Data Destruction:
- Proof of Destruction: We provide certificates of data destruction to confirm that data on hardware has been securely erased or physically destroyed.
- Audit Trails: Detailed records are maintained to track the disposal process and ensure compliance with data protection regulations.
3.2 Compliance with Regulations:
- GDPR Compliance: Our disposal procedures are aligned with GDPR requirements to ensure that personal data is handled securely.
- WEEE Directive: We follow the WEEE Directive to manage e-waste in a way that meets regulatory standards and promotes recycling.
